Projects page setup
This commit is contained in:
@ -30,31 +30,4 @@
|
||||
</div>
|
||||
</div>
|
||||
</div>
|
||||
|
||||
<script type="text/javascript">
|
||||
document.addEventListener("DOMContentLoaded", function (event) {
|
||||
var projectsListElt = document.querySelector('#projectsList');
|
||||
var projectsTableElt = document.querySelector('#projectsTable');
|
||||
var projectDivElt = document.querySelector('#projectDiv');
|
||||
var projectDetailElt = document.querySelector('#projectDetail');
|
||||
var projectTitleElt = document.querySelector('#projectTitle');
|
||||
var projectsListTitleElt = document.querySelector('#projectsListTitle');
|
||||
projectsListElt.addEventListener('select', function (event) {
|
||||
projectsTableElt.style.display = 'none';
|
||||
projectsListTitleElt.style.display = 'none';
|
||||
projectDivElt.style.display = 'block';
|
||||
projectTitleElt.style.display ='block';
|
||||
projectDetailElt.setAttribute("data-src", event.detail.resource['@id']);
|
||||
projectTitleElt.setAttribute("data-src", event.detail.resource['@id']);
|
||||
});
|
||||
projectDivElt.addEventListener('click', function (event) {
|
||||
if (event.target.id == "projectDivBackButton") {
|
||||
projectDivElt.style.display = 'none';
|
||||
projectTitleElt.style.display = 'none';
|
||||
projectsTableElt.style.display = 'block';
|
||||
projectsListTitleElt.style.display = 'block';
|
||||
}
|
||||
});
|
||||
});
|
||||
</script>
|
||||
</div>
|
||||
|
@ -1,10 +1,8 @@
|
||||
<div id="projects" style="display: none">
|
||||
<ldp-display
|
||||
id="projectsList"
|
||||
id="projects-list"
|
||||
data-src="http://localhost:8000/projects/"
|
||||
set-label="number, label-separator, name"
|
||||
value-label-separator=" - "
|
||||
data-fields="label"
|
||||
data-fields="number, name"
|
||||
search-fields="number, name"
|
||||
next="project"
|
||||
></ldp-display>
|
||||
|
Reference in New Issue
Block a user